The Internet and new technologies such as tablets and smartphones have had a great effect on our daily lives and have improved the education of all children, but with the use of these technologies there are some associated risks. At Sacred Heart, e-safety is a topic which is revisited throughout each year. Students are given an introduction to understanding the risks associated with the internet and how they can stay safe online. This is a brief outline of what we cover in each year.
Year Group | Topics |
---|---|
1 | Being Safe Online |
2 | Stranger Danger |
3 | Stranger Danger; SMART Rules for Internet Safety |
4 | SMART Rules for Internet Safety |
5 | Keeping E-safe – cyberbullying, mobile phones, abusive texts, digital video, social networking, instant messaging, premium rate numbers |
6 | Keeping E-safe – security of personal information, online identity, online grooming, internet chatrooms, social networking, mobile phones and texting |
